(ø,ø): Never noticed this when I looked at your airtable previously, but it looks like the offline installers are actually more up-to-date than the galaxy builds in a few of the older cases.
There have always been quite a few, and I'm marking these situations as "discrepancies" as well, however there's no braintwister here or reason to worry about them. They're simply due to some Galaxy build versions not being made public in the API (since all the offline installers are actually linked to a Galaxy build). So an API issue that I'm hoping GOG will address some day.
